Ундервуд is a band from Ukraine named after Underwood typewriter. It was formed by two doctors from Crimea — Maksim Kucherenko and Vladimir Tkachenko. The band tries to revive russian-retro-rock motives in modern music, at the same time bringing intellectual rock to a new level.
The band has released five albums so far —
2002 — Everything Will Pass, Honey (Все пройдет, милая)
2003 — The Red Button (Красная кнопка)
2005 — Loot’s Ruling Over Evil (Бабло побеждает зло)
2007 — Opium for the People (Опиум для народа)

2008 — Everybody you loved so much (Все, кого ты так сильно любил)
They’ve also written the song that became cult for a time being and revived the image of Gagarin in russian minds — “Gagarin, I loved you” (Гагарин, я вас любила).
Maksim and Vladimir have also published two books of their poetry called “Sound and Silence” (Звук и Тишина) and “Opera et Studio”.
